JAKARTA Asma is still one of the chronic diseases that is often found in children. Asma that is not handled properly has long-term impacts.
Asthma is a chronic disease in respiratory salura which is characterized by shortness of breath due to inflammation and narrowing of the respiratory tract. People with asthma can be from various age groups, both young and old.
People with asthma have a respiratory tract that is more sensitive than normal people. When the lungs are exposed to triggering asthma, the muscles in the respiratory tract will be stiff so that the channel narrows. In addition, phlegm production also increases.
The Indonesian Ministry of Health in 2018 reported that 2.4 percent of all Indonesians had asthma. Meanwhile, data from the World Health Organization (WHO) in 2019 noted that people with asthma worldwide reached 262 million people, with the death toll from asthma reaching 461,000 people.
Secretary of the Respirology Coordination Work Unit of the Indonesian Pediatrician Association (IDAI) Dr. Wahyuni Indawati, Sp.A Subsp. Respi(K) said, the number of incidences of asthma in children tends to be higher than adults.
"The number of asthma events varies between countries, but it is estimated that around 20 percent in children. If calculated globally, it currently reaches 300 million people and is predicted to increase to 400 million by 2025," Wahyuni said in an online webinar organized by IDAI.
It is not known what causes children to experience asthma. However, asthma is a disease due to genetic disorders. The risk of asthma is getting higher when there is a history of family members, both parents or siblings with asthma.

Although the exact cause is unknown, children who suffer from respiratory asthma become more sensitive and easily narrow when exposed to the originator, such as dust, pollution, or excessive physical activity.

In children, the characteristic symptoms of asthma can be observed, among others, from recurrent coughs, shortness of breath, and breathing sounds ngicles'', especially at night or early morning. If parents know the symptoms of asthma and can control it well, then the child can still undergo normal activities without being disturbed by attacks.
Most Indonesians think that children with asthma should limit physical activity so as not to trigger recurrence of symptoms. However, this claim was actually denied by Wahyuni.
He emphasized that with proper control, children with asthma can still do activities like other children. Limiting physical activity is not the main solution in dealing with asthma in children.
Physical activities such as swimming, walking can still be done by children with asthma while still monitoring body reactions while doing these physical activities.
"Children's asthma doesn't mean they can't exercise or play. Instead, we want children to stay active, as long as their asthma is under control," he said.
"So the point is not to limit, but to manage well. In fact, athletes like David Beckham also have asthma, but can still excel," Wahyuni added.
So that children can grow optimally, Wahyuni encourages parents to recognize and avoid symptoms originators such as home dust, animal hair, food with preservatives, to cigarette smoke.
"Asma in children cannot be completely cured, but can be controlled by proper handling. If controlled, children can grow and develop like other children without any significant disturbances," explained Wahyuni.
"With appropriate treatment and controlling the triggering factor, children with asthma can grow healthy and carry out activities like other children," he continued.
If asthma is not handled properly, it can cause children's weight growth to be disrupted. Therefore, it is important for parents to understand the complaints experienced by children so that they can provide proper assistance.
